if you ask me it purely depends on how you think they view you and how you view them. I would bet here because I cb nearly all the time and I think check then a turn c/raise after a raise preflop just screams a monster at this level. I'd bet, hope one of them as a worse ace and is going to pay me off, because otherwise I don't think there are many hands you going to get money off anyways.
